Output 9435bd0d959c23f7687ecd1c559912a2ce7dd40da66ee4b470869ad42f5e7194:1

value
2687872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cdab6a27ce53f53681304a2d882994fac18047 OP_EQUAL
address
MBM3chdvwdZCvqxXFUGrrTKxWYsWq92t1P
transaction
9435bd0d959c23f7687ecd1c559912a2ce7dd40da66ee4b470869ad42f5e7194
spent
true